Abstract

An insulation structure to prevent frost between waterproof sheets for a tunnel is provided to stop drain pipes from freezing and drain water smoothly by installing an insulating member between a waterproof sheet and a lining concrete. An insulation structure to prevent frost between waterproof sheets for a tunnel comprises a shotcrete, a waterproof layer(120), a lining concrete(130), and an insulating member(140). The waterproof layer includes a nonwoven fabric(122) and a waterproof sheet(124) which are laid on the surface of the shotcrete. The lining concrete is poured on the waterproof layer. The insulating member is laminated between the waterproof sheet and the lining concrete.

본 발명은 터널용 방수시트 사이의 누수방지 구조에 관한 것으로, 보다 상세하게는, 단열수단을 구비하여 한랭지 또는 추운 날씨에서도 배수관의 동결방지 및 콘크리트 라이닝 배면의 지하수 결빙을 방지할 수 있도록 한 터널용 방수시트 사이의 동상방지용 단열 구조에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a leak-proof structure between the waterproof sheet for the tunnel, and more particularly, the tunnel is provided with a heat insulating means to prevent freezing of the drain pipe and cold groundwater on the back of the concrete lining even in cold or cold weather The present invention relates to an insulation structure for preventing frostbite between waterproof sheets.

일반적으로, 터널은 교통, 통수 등의 목적으로 산악, 지하 또는 수저 등에 홀을 형성한 갱도를 말하는 것으로, 주로, 도로 또는 철도 등의 건설시 경로를 확보하기 위해 건설된다. In general, a tunnel refers to a tunnel in which a hole is formed in a mountain, an underground, a cutlery, or the like for the purpose of transportation, water passage, etc., and is mainly constructed to secure a path during construction of a road or a railway.

도 1 은, 종래의 터널 누수방지 구조를 도시한 단면도이다.1 is a cross-sectional view showing a conventional tunnel leak prevention structure.

도시된 바와 같이, 터널의 시공 예정 부위에 굴착 또는 발파 작업을 통하여 기초터널을 형성하고, 쇼크리트(Shotcrete, 20)를 분사하여 시공한 후, 방수층(30)을 시공한 다음, 터널 내벽을 보호하는 라이닝 콘크리트(Lining Concret, 40)를 타설하는 방식으로 이루어진다. 이 과정에서, 방수층(30)은 쇼크리트(20) 시공면의 상부에 부직포를 고정 설치하고, 이 부직포의 상부에 방수시트를 적층함으로써 형성된다. 그리고, 쇼크리트(20)를 통과하여 내부로 유입된 물이 부직포를 따라 하부로 흘러내려 배수될 수 있도록 터널과 나란하게 설치된 종배수관(50) 및 터널의 내측방향으로 소정의 경사각을 가지고 구비된 횡배수관(60)을 통해 유입되어 배수수단(70)을 통해 배수되도록 이루어져 있다. As shown, after forming the foundation tunnel through the excavation or blasting work to the construction site of the tunnel, by spraying the shotcrete (20), after constructing the waterproof layer 30, and then protects the tunnel inner wall Lining concrete (40) is made by pouring. In this process, the waterproof layer 30 is formed by fixing the nonwoven fabric on top of the construction surface of the shockcrete 20 and laminating the waterproof sheet on the top of the nonwoven fabric. In addition, the water drainage pipe 50 is installed in parallel with the tunnel and has a predetermined inclination angle in the inner direction of the tunnel so that the water introduced into the interior through the shockcrete 20 flows down the drain along the nonwoven fabric. Is introduced through the horizontal drain pipe 60 is made to drain through the drain means (70).

그러나, 종래의 터널의 방수구조에 의하면, 예를 들어, 외기의 온도가 -15℃ 이하일 경우, 터널(10) 내로 차가운 외기가 유입되면서 종배수관(50)과 횡배수관(60)의 내부온도가 영하로 떨어져 종배수관(50)과 횡배수관(60)의 결빙으로 배수 기능이 저하되어 지하수가 방수층(30)과 라이닝 콘크리트(20) 사이로 역류되고, 시공 이음부를 따라 상승되면서 고드름 등이 형성되고, 기온 상승시 융해되어 낙수현상이 발생하는 문제점이 있었다. 또한, 일평균 기온이 0℃ 이하의 온도가 300℃·day 이상인 동결지수를 갖는 한랭지인 경우 지반의 동결에 의한 라이닝 콘크리트(20)의 동상 가능성이 존재한다.However, according to the conventional waterproof structure of the tunnel, for example, when the temperature of the outside air is -15 ℃ or less, the internal temperature of the vertical drain pipe 50 and the horizontal drain pipe 60 is increased while the cold outside air flows into the tunnel 10 Falling below zero, the drainage function is reduced by the freezing of the vertical drainage pipe 50 and the horizontal drainage pipe 60, the groundwater flows back between the waterproofing layer 30 and the lining concrete 20, as the icicles are formed while rising along the construction joint, There was a problem in that the fall caused by melting when the temperature rises. In addition, when the daily average temperature is a cold district having a freezing index of 300 ° C day or more at a temperature of 0 ° C or less, there is a possibility of frostbite of the lining concrete 20 by the freezing of the ground.

이러한, 문제점을 해결하기 위해 열유동 해석을 통한 소요 열량과 설치 위치 등을 산정함으로써 열풍기 및 시공이음부에 열선 등을 설치하여 기온이 급격히 저하될 때 가동되도록 하는 방안이 개시되어 있으나, 이러한 경우, 열풍기 및 열선 등의 별도의 동결방지수단을 구비 및 동결방지수단의 고장시 이를 수리 또는 교환해야 하는 데에도 막대한 예산 및 시간이 소요되는 문제점이 있었다. In order to solve such a problem, a method of installing a heating wire on a hot air fan and a construction joint by calculating a required heat amount and an installation position through thermal flow analysis is disclosed so as to operate when the temperature drops sharply. There is a problem in that a huge budget and time are required to provide a separate freeze protection means such as a hot air fan and a heating wire and to repair or replace the freeze protection means.

또한, 한랭지 또는 추운 날씨에서 터널에 발생되는 물을 배수하는 배수관이 동결되어 배수효율이 저하되고, 이로 인해, 동결되지 않은 지하수의 수위가 상승함에 따라 라이닝 콘크리트에 수압이 설계한 값보다 크게 되어 라이닝 콘크리트에 균열 발생 및 터널이 붕괴되는 현상 또는 터널라이닝 배면의 지하수 동결에 의한 동상 발생으로 동상에 의한 팽창압이 라이닝 콘크리트에 작용하여 균열, 열화 등으로 터널이 붕괴되는 현상 등의 심각한 재해를 발생시킬 수도 있다. In addition, the drainage pipe that drains the water generated in the tunnel in the cold or cold weather is frozen, and the drainage efficiency is lowered. As a result, the water pressure in the lining concrete becomes greater than the designed value as the level of the unfrozen groundwater rises. Due to cracks in concrete and tunnel collapse or frostbite caused by freezing of groundwater on the back of tunnel lining, expansion pressure due to frostbite acts on lining concrete, which can cause severe disasters such as tunnel collapse due to cracking and deterioration. It may be.

상기와 같은 기술적 과제를 해결하기 위해 안출된 본 발명에 따른 터널용 방수시트 사이의 누수방지 구조에 의하면, 터널의 쇼크리트 타설 면에 부직포와 방수시트가 고정 설치되어 방수층이 형성되고, 이 방수층에 라이닝 콘크리트가 타설되어 이루어지는 터널용 방수층의 누수방지 구조에 있어서, 방수시트 및 라이닝 콘크리트의 사이에 적층되는 단열수단을 포함하는 것을 특징으로 한다.According to the leak-proof structure between the waterproof sheet for the tunnel according to the present invention devised to solve the technical problem as described above, the non-woven fabric and the waterproof sheet is fixed to the shock-creating surface of the tunnel, the waterproof layer is formed, the waterproof layer In the leakage preventing structure of the waterproof layer for tunnels in which the lining concrete is poured, it characterized in that it comprises a heat insulating means laminated between the waterproof sheet and the lining concrete.

그리고, 단열수단은 외부로의 열손실이나 열의 유입을 방지하기 위한 단열재; 이 단열재의 일측면에 구비되는 접착수단; 단열재의 타측면에 구비되는 물 침투 방지재; 를 포함한다.And, the heat insulating means is a heat insulating material for preventing heat loss or heat inflow to the outside; Bonding means provided on one side of the heat insulating material; A water penetration preventing material provided on the other side of the heat insulating material; It includes.

또한, 접착수단은 사용되기 전 이형지에 의해 점착면이 보호되도록 하는 것이 바람직하다. In addition, the adhesive means is preferably such that the adhesive surface is protected by a release paper before use.

아울러, 단열재는 폴리에틸렌 재질로 이루어진다. In addition, the insulation is made of polyethylene.

그리고, 단열재의 두께는 5 ㎜ ~ 50 ㎜ 로 형성하는 것이 바람직하다. And it is preferable to form the thickness of a heat insulating material in 5 mm-50 mm.

또한, 물 침투 방지재는 일면에 선택적으로 수평 및 수직으로 복수개의 굽힘안내자국이 형성되도록 한다. 이러한 물 침투 방지재는, 양면에 굽힘안내자국이 형성되어야 굴곡이 있는 쇼크리트 시공면 위에 부착된 방수시트 위에 잘 부착될 수 있다. In addition, the water penetration prevention material allows a plurality of bending guide marks to be formed horizontally and vertically on one surface. Such a water permeation prevention material may be well attached on a waterproof sheet attached to a curved shockcrete construction surface when bending guide marks are formed on both surfaces thereof.

먼저, 터널(100)의 시공 예정 부위에 굴착 기기를 이용하여 굴착을 행하거나, 암반(150) 등이 있는 경우는 화약 장전에 의한 발파 작업을 통하여 기초터널을 형성한다.First, excavation is carried out by using an excavation device in the construction site of the tunnel 100, or when there is a rock 150 or the like, a foundation tunnel is formed through a blasting operation due to gunpowder loading.

이와 같이, 형성된 기초터널의 굴착면은 굴곡이 심하여 후속 방수 작업을 하기에 부적합하므로, 기초터널의 굴착면을 안정시킴과 아울러 방수 바탕면을 평탄하게 만들기 위해 쇼크리트(110)를 분사하여 시공한다. 이 쇼크리트(110)는 암반굴착면에 삽입·고정되는 록 볼트(112) 등에 의해 암반(150)에 고정된다.Thus, since the excavation surface of the formed foundation tunnel is severely unsuitable for subsequent waterproofing work, the shockcrete 110 is sprayed to stabilize the excavation surface of the foundation tunnel and to flatten the waterproof base surface. . The shockcrete 110 is fixed to the rock 150 by a lock bolt 112 or the like inserted into and fixed to the rock excavation surface.

그리고, 기초터널 내부로 유입되는 지하수의 침투를 방지하기 위해 방수층(120)을 시공한 다음, 터널 내벽을 보호하는 콘크리트 보각 벽체인 라이닝 콘크리트(130)를 타설하는 방식으로 이루어진다. Then, the waterproof layer 120 is constructed to prevent the penetration of groundwater flowing into the basic tunnel, and then the lining concrete 130 that is a concrete complementary wall to protect the inner wall of the tunnel is formed.

즉, 터널(100)의 시공은, 발파 작업 → 쇼크리트 분사 시공 → 방수층 시공 → 라이닝 콘크리트 타설 과정을 통해 이루어지는 것이다. That is, the construction of the tunnel 100 is performed through the blasting work → shock spraying construction → waterproofing layer construction → lining concrete pouring process.

이 과정에서, 방수층(120)은 쇼크리트(110) 시공면의 상부에 부직포(122)를 고정 설치하고, 이 부직포(122)의 상부에 비닐시트 등의 분리형 방수시트(124)를 적층함으로써 형성된다. In this process, the waterproof layer 120 is formed by fixing the nonwoven fabric 122 to the top of the construction surface of the shockcrete 110, and by stacking a separate waterproof sheet 124 such as a vinyl sheet on top of the nonwoven fabric 122. do.

또한, 방수시트(124) 및 라이닝 콘크리트(130)의 사이에는 배수관의 동결을 방지하기 위해 적층되는 단열수단(140)이 구비된다.In addition, the insulating sheet 140 is provided between the waterproof sheet 124 and the lining concrete 130 is laminated to prevent the freezing of the drain pipe.

이러한, 단열수단(140)은 외부로의 열손실이나 열의 유입을 방지하기 위한 단열재(HIM : Heat Insulating Material)(142)을 포함한다. The heat insulation means 140 includes a heat insulating material (HIM) 142 for preventing heat loss or inflow of heat to the outside.

그리고, 단열재(142)의 타측면에 물 침투 방지재(146)를 구비하여 라이닝 콘크리트(130) 타설시 콘크리트에 포함된 수분이 단열재(142) 내부로 침투하여 단열효과가 저하되는 것을 방지하도록 한다. 이 물침투 방지재(146)는 일면 또는 양면에 선택적으로 수평 및 수직으로 복수개의 굽힘안내자국(146a)가 형성되도록 함으로써 적층되는 부위의 어느 곳에서도 원할하게 굽힘이 이루어질 수 있도록 하고, 이로 인해, 호형으로 시공되는 방수시트(124) 및 라이닝 콘크리트(130) 사이에서 용이하게 적층될 수 있어 작업효율을 향상시킬 수 있게 된다.In addition, the water penetrating prevention material 146 is provided on the other side of the heat insulating material 142 to prevent the moisture contained in the concrete from penetrating into the heat insulating material 142 when the lining concrete 130 is poured to prevent the heat insulating effect from deteriorating. . The water penetration prevention material 146 allows a plurality of bending guide marks 146a to be selectively formed horizontally and vertically on one or both surfaces thereof, so that the bending can be smoothly performed anywhere in the stacked portion. It can be easily laminated between the waterproof sheet 124 and the lining concrete 130 is constructed in an arc shape can improve the work efficiency.

또한, 단열재(142)의 일측면에 접착제 등의 접착수단(144)을 구비하여 단열재(142)가 방수시트(124) 측으로 접착될 수 있도록 한다. 이러한, 접착수단(144)은 사용되기 전 이형지(145)에 의해 점착면이 보호되도록 하고, 단열수단(140)의 시공시 이형지(145)를 떼어내어 방수시트(124) 측에 접착될 수 있도록 한다. In addition, the one side of the heat insulating material 142 is provided with an adhesive means such as an adhesive 144 so that the heat insulating material 142 can be bonded to the waterproof sheet 124 side. Such, the adhesive means 144 is to be protected by the adhesive paper 145 before being used, and to remove the release paper 145 during construction of the thermal insulation means 140 to be bonded to the waterproof sheet 124 side. do.

아울러, 단열재(142)는 폴리에틸렌(Polyethylene) 재질로 이루어지도록 하고, 그 두께(T)는 5 ㎜ ~ 50 ㎜ 로 형성하는 것이 적절하다. In addition, the heat insulating material 142 is made of polyethylene (Polyethylene) material, the thickness (T) is preferably formed to be 5 mm to 50 mm.

즉, 지반으로부터 쇼크리트(110)를 침투한 물은 부직포(122)를 침투하거나 방수 시트(124)에 의해 차단되며, 부직포(122)를 따라 흘러내린 물이 종배수관(160)을 통하여 소정의 경사각을 가지고 구비된 횡배수관(170)을 통과하여 배수 수단(180)을 통해 외부로 배수된다.That is, the water penetrating the shockcrete 110 from the ground penetrates the nonwoven fabric 122 or is blocked by the waterproof sheet 124, and the water flowing along the nonwoven fabric 122 passes through the vertical drainage pipe 160. Passed through the horizontal drain pipe 170 provided with an inclination angle is drained to the outside through the drain means (180).
